The first Earth Day took place in the U.S. in 1970.Conceived as a nationwide environmental protest, it set out “to shake up thepolitical establishment.” It succeeded when 20 million took to the streets, todemand a healthy and sustainable environment. In 1990, Earth Day went global, mobilising 200 millionpeople in 141 countries. The situation is urgent. We need system change, notclimate change. After all, good planets are hard to find!
